Art in the Park features new pig roast lunch option

Saturday & Sunday, Aug. 12-13—RUTLAND—The Chaffee Art Center presents its annual Art in the Park festival over the weekend of Aug. 12-13 in Rutland’s Main Street Park, at the corner of Route 7 (Main Street) and West Street. Festival hours are Saturday, Aug. 12, 10 a.m.-5 p.m. and Sunday, Aug. 13, 10 a.m.-4 p.m.

For the past 10 years, Art in the Park has been voted Rutland Herald’s “Best of the Best” in the category of Best Arts Festival and is one of the Rutland area’s most enjoyable events.

This year’s event will feature a pig roast on Saturday with proceeds going to local non-profit organizations, including the Chaffee Art Center. Other food vendors and specialty foods will be available throughout the park. All patrons entering the event will have the chance to win $25 in “Chaffee Bucks” to spend at any vendor in the park. Live demonstrations from local artists, kids’ activities, face painting and live music can be enjoyed both days. Come see beautiful creations from over 60 vendors showcasing their work in jewelry, painting, photography, fiber arts, wood, stone and much more.
